How can the future of dance cross boundaries, social, physical, cultural? How can dance better contribute to a rich and harmonious urban life?
Motivation for this project stems from a commitment to reveal and highlight the importance of dance in how we live, learn
and relate to each other. Passionate about dance, as an art form; as an experience of the body while striving to highlight the
importance of dance in a society that is exponentially changing as a result of new technologies.
Exponential technologies are those which are rapidly accelerating and shaping major industries and all aspects of our lives; artificial intelligence (AI), augmented and virtual reality (AR, VR), data science, digital biology and biotech, medicine, nanotech and digital fabrication, networks and computing systems, robotics, and autonomous vehicles.
Solutions to the world’s most pressing challenges lie at the intersection of these exponential technologies.
The conversation will begin with a series of questions:
How can we bring dance into this conversation?
How can the knowledge of the dance community influence the formation of our future?
How will the body be viewed in the future?
How will dance be impacted?
How can dance impact our future world for the better?
For example, consider a potential physical experience that connects dancers and audience by biosensors - connecting heart
beats and generating a new experience of dance. Or, consider another solution that might use choreography and blockchain
technology, to develop AI to deepen our understanding how certain movements impact our emotional wellbeing. These are
the types of solutions we are trying to mobilize in dance, through the learning in this project.
